🔥 Positioning is Everything

"The biggest mistake new players make is sailing in a straight line," says "DestroyerKing_99." "Always angle your ship, use islands for cover, and never show broadside to the enemy. In World of Warships, positioning beats aim 80% of the time."

🎯 Aiming & Lead

"Use the dynamic crosshair and learn to lead your shots. Each ship has different shell velocity, so practice in the training room. The Aslain World Of Warships modpack has a great aiming tool that shows the optimal lead indicator."

🛡️ Consumable Management

"Don't pop your Damage Control Party the moment you get a fire. Wait for two fires or a flood. Same with Repair Party — use it only when you've lost at least 30% of your health. This is what separates good players from great ones."
